CHOOSING THE RIGHT DEVICES FOR EFFECTIVE AUTOMATION TESTING SOLUTIONS

Choosing the Right Devices for Effective Automation Testing Solutions

Choosing the Right Devices for Effective Automation Testing Solutions

Blog Article

Opening the Power of Automation Examining: Best Practices, Devices, and Approaches to Simplify Your Screening Refine



Automation screening has become a keystone in contemporary software program advancement methods, providing a myriad of benefits such as enhanced performance, faster time-to-market, and enhanced general top quality (automation testing). The course to utilizing the power of automation testing is paved with insights and methods that can change just how software is examined and provided.


Value of Automation Evaluating



Automation testing plays a crucial role in modern software application growth by boosting effectiveness, decreasing human error, and ensuring the high quality of software. Applying automation testing permits the implementation of recurring examination situations, regression screening, and efficiency screening in an extra effective and trusted fashion. By automating these processes, software development groups can conserve time and resources that would certainly or else be invested on manual testing.


Moreover, automation testing substantially minimizes the probability of human mistake, as the tests are performed consistently and specifically each time they are performed. This consistency causes extra trusted results and helps identify problems early in the development procedure. Additionally, automation testing helps with constant combination and constant shipment methods by giving quick feedback on the quality of the software.


Ideal Practices for Automation Testing



Effectively implementing automated screening techniques can substantially improve the total top quality and integrity of software. To make certain effective automation screening, it is important to adhere to finest practices that streamline the screening procedure and optimize its effectiveness.


To start with, it is important to thoroughly strategize the automation and intend technique. This entails recognizing the right test cases for automation, establishing clear goals, and establishing realistic assumptions. Prioritizing tests based on essential capabilities and prospective influence on the software application is key to maximizing automation efforts.


Second of all, maintaining a robust and scalable examination automation framework is important for long-lasting success (automation testing). Utilizing recyclable and modular test manuscripts, implementing appropriate variation control, and consistently upgrading examination instances to reflect modifications in the software application are basic facets of a sustainable automation approach




In addition, integrating constant integration practices right into the automation process assists in identifying problems early and making sure smooth collaboration amongst employee. By adhering to these best practices, organizations can leverage automation screening to attain greater effectiveness, enhanced software application quality, and faster time-to-market.


Important Tools for Automation Checking



Having established a solid structure with finest practices for automation screening, the next essential step is to recognize and use the important tools necessary for reliable examination automation. These devices play a crucial role in improving the screening process, boosting productivity, and ensuring the top quality of software program applications.


automation testingautomation testing
Among the essential devices for automation testing is an automation framework, such as Selenium or Appium, which provides an organized environment for examination manuscripts to run smoothly across different platforms and web browsers. Constant Integration (CI) devices like Jenkins or Bamboo are essential for automating the build and check implementation process, allowing quick responses on code modifications.


For effective test administration and cooperation, devices like Jira, TestRail, or HP ALM can aid in organizing examination cases, tracking issues, and assisting in interaction among group members. Furthermore, performance screening tools like JMeter or LoadRunner are critical for analyzing the scalability and stability of applications under varying tons conditions. By leveraging these essential tools, organizations can improve their automation testing abilities and attain faster time-to-market with high-grade software.


Approaches for Improving Examining Process



To maximize the testing procedure and boost total effectiveness, calculated planning and thorough implementation are paramount in attaining structured testing procedures (automation testing). One efficient other strategy for streamlining the screening process is to focus on test instances based on their effect and frequency of usage. By concentrating on high-impact test situations that cover essential functionalities and are frequently made use of by end-users, teams can designate resources a lot more effectively and make certain that one of the most crucial aspects of the application are extensively examined


Additionally, applying a risk-based screening method can help streamline the testing process by focusing on and recognizing test scenarios based on prospective dangers to the application. By analyzing the effect and likelihood of various dangers, screening efforts can be routed in the direction of locations of the application that are most at risk to failure, hence taking full advantage of the effectiveness of the screening procedure.


Furthermore, establishing clear interaction channels and partnership between cross-functional teams can promote the sharing of information, demands, and feedback, resulting in an extra structured and worked with screening process. By promoting a culture of openness and collaboration, teams can collaborate better towards achieving usual testing objectives and objectives.


Making The Most Of Effectiveness With Automation



automation testingautomation testing
Building upon the foundation of calculated preparation and thorough implementation in enhancing the testing process, the following vital emphasis is on using automation to take full advantage of testing performance. special info Automation plays an important duty in boosting efficiency by lowering manual intervention, increasing examination execution, and ensuring consistent examination end results. To take full advantage of efficiency with automation, it is important to identify recurring and lengthy test instances that can be automated to conserve sources and time. Prioritizing examinations based upon urgency and frequency of implementation is important to optimize the automation process properly.


Working together carefully with advancement teams to integrate automatic screening into the continual integration/continuous release (CI/CD) pipeline can improve the testing procedure and assist in faster feedback loopholes for quicker problem resolution. By leveraging automation successfully, screening groups can dramatically improve efficiency and supply top notch software options successfully.


Final Thought



In conclusion, automation testing plays an essential duty in improving the testing procedure, enhancing effectiveness, and ensuring the high quality of software applications. By implementing best practices, utilizing important tools, and planning to maximize efficiency, organizations can unlock the power of automation screening. It is necessary to focus on automation screening in software program advancement to accomplish faster shipment, better items, and overall success in the electronic landscape.


Applying automation testing allows for the execution of repetitive examination cases, regression screening, and efficiency testing in a much more efficient and dependable way.To optimize the testing process and improve total efficiency, strategic planning and careful implementation are critical in attaining structured testing procedures.Building upon the structure of tactical planning and careful implementation in enhancing the testing procedure, the next crucial emphasis is on taking advantage of automation to make the most of testing efficiency. Collaborating closely with advancement groups official site to incorporate computerized screening into the continuous integration/continuous release (CI/CD) pipeline can enhance the screening procedure and promote faster responses loops for quicker issue resolution.In conclusion, automation testing plays a critical duty in simplifying the screening procedure, improving performance, and guaranteeing the high quality of software applications.

Report this page